Job Overview

A law firm is seeking a dedicated and experienced Pre-Suit Personal Injury Attorney to join their team in Gainesville, FL. This role involves managing a heavy caseload, negotiating settlements, and maintaining regular client communication.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in personal injury law, excellent communication skills, and a passion for helping needy clients.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Gather necessary documents, evidence, and relevant information related to claims.
  • Negotiate settlement offers with insurance providers.
  • Effectively manage a full caseload.
  • Oversee and manage a dedicated full-time legal assistant.
  • Maintain regular communication with clients, ensuring they are informed and supported.
  • Open new files, make initial client contact and maintain ongoing communication.
  • Fully investigate each case, gathering and analyzing intake information and relevant documents.
  • Enter pertinent information into the ATO database.
  • Verify insurance coverage and liability issues; maintain contact with insurance companies.
  • Manage clients’ medical care, constantly communicating with clients and medical providers.
  • Schedule and calendar medical appointments; explain procedures and documentation to clients.
  • Continuously monitor case status and review medical records.
  • Organize and maintain case files, preparing files to be submitted to demand writers.
